详解Linux 中五个重启命令

详解Linux中五个重启命令的完整攻略

在Linux系统中,有五个常用的命令可以重启系统。这些命令包括:

  1. reboot
  2. halt
  3. poweroff
  4. init 6
  5. shutdown

接下来,我们将对这些命令进行详细的讲解,同时介绍它们各自的用法和示例。

1. reboot

reboot 是一个常用的Linux命令,用于重启系统。

$ reboot

该命令会发出一个重启系统的信号,并在一定时间后重启系统。如果想立即重启系统,可以使用 -f 参数:

$ reboot -f

2. halt

halt 命令用于关闭系统,但不会重启系统。

$ halt

当执行该命令时,系统会停止运行,但不会自动重启。如果需要重启系统,需要手动按下计算机的电源按钮。

3. poweroff

poweroff 命令用于关闭系统,并在关闭后将计算机的电源完全关闭。

$ poweroff

当执行该命令时,系统会停止运行,并在关闭后关闭计算机的电源。与 halt 命令相比,poweroff 命令将电源完全关闭,因此更安全。

4. init 6

init 6 命令是通过运行 init 程序来重启系统。

$ init 6

当执行该命令时,系统将被重启。与 reboot 命令相比,init 6 命令是直接通过 init 程序来重启系统,而不是向内核发送一个重启信号。

5. shutdown

shutdown 命令用于安全地关闭系统,并重启或者停止电源。

$ shutdown -r now

该命令会发出一个警告信号,告诉所有用户系统将要关闭,并在一定时间后重启系统。如果想立即重启系统,可以使用 -r 参数。如果要停止系统,则可以使用 -h 参数。

以上就是Linux中常用的五个重启命令的详细讲解和用法示例。无论是在服务器还是个人电脑上,熟练掌握这些命令都是非常重要的。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:详解Linux 中五个重启命令 - Python技术站

(0)
上一篇 2023年5月22日
下一篇 2023年5月22日

相关文章

  • Centos MySQL 5.7安装、升级教程

    CentOS 7上安装MySQL 5.7 MySQL 5.7是当前最新稳定版本,它的新特性包括更好的性能和可扩展性,更好的JSON支持和更大的安全性。在CentOS 7上,MySQL 5.7安装过程如下: 更新系统 在安装MySQL 5.7之前,我们需要先更新系统: yum update -y 添加MySQL Yum Repository 下载MySQL Y…

    database 2023年5月22日
    00
  • 在Mac OS上安装Oracle数据库的基本方法

    下面是详细讲解在Mac OS上安装Oracle数据库的基本方法的完整攻略。 确认环境 在安装Oracle之前,首先需要确认以下条件: Mac OS版本:Oracle 12c仅支持OS X 10.10 Yosemite及以上版本,Oracle 11g支持OS X 10.6及以上版本; 硬件要求:建议内存至少为2GB,空闲磁盘空间不少于10GB; 下载Oracl…

    database 2023年5月22日
    00
  • SQL 计算行数

    下面是SQL计算行数的攻略以及两个实例。 什么是SQL计算行数 SQL计算行数是指在数据库中进行数据查询时,我们可以使用SQL内置的函数COUNT()计算满足条件的记录数量,也就是行数。这个功能在实际开发中非常实用,可以帮助我们快速得到某个查询条件下的记录总数。 COUNT()函数使用方法 COUNT()函数是SQL中非常常用的一个聚合函数,主要用于计算满足…

    database 2023年3月27日
    00
  • Oracle中 关于数据库存储过程和存储函数的使用

    下面我详细讲解一下有关Oracle数据库存储过程和存储函数的使用攻略。 1. 什么是存储过程和存储函数? 存储过程和存储函数是SQL Server中的两个重要的对象,相比于传统的SQL语句,它们可以提高SQL语句的复用性和可维护性。存储过程和存储函数是事先编写好的一组SQL语句,封装在数据库服务器中,在需要的时候被调用执行,可以完成一系列复杂的操作。其中,存…

    database 2023年5月21日
    00
  • MySQL如何为字段添加默认时间浅析

    MySQL为字段添加默认时间的方法是使用DEFAULT关键字和NOW()函数结合。 首先,在创建表时,可以在定义字段时为字段添加DEFAULT关键字和NOW()函数。例如,我们创建一个名为users的表,其中包含一个创建时间字段create_time和一个修改时间字段update_time,它们都有一个默认值为当前时间: CREATE TABLE users…

    database 2023年5月22日
    00
  • Springboot Redis 哨兵模式的实现示例

    下面是关于“Springboot Redis 哨兵模式的实现示例”的完整攻略。 什么是Springboot Redis 哨兵模式? 在单个Redis节点出现故障后,整个Redis集群将会崩溃。因此,为了保障Redis集群的高可靠性,Redis提供了Redis哨兵(Sentinel)模式。Redis哨兵模式是通过引入Redis哨兵进程(Sentinel pro…

    database 2023年5月22日
    00
  • Neo4j和Redis的区别

    Neo4j和Redis都是流行的开源非关系型数据库系统,在具体的应用场景下,两者都可以提供不同的优势和特点。下面详细介绍Neo4j和Redis的区别: Neo4j:基于图形的数据库系统 Neo4j是一种基于图形的数据库系统,它的数据结构是通过节点、边和图形表示的。因此,它特别适合于处理复杂的数据关系,例如社交网络、推荐系统、网络拓扑图等。Neo4j使用CQL…

    database 2023年3月27日
    00
  • android设备不识别awk命令 缺少busybox怎么办

    Android设备不识别awk命令 缺少Busybox解决方案 在某些情况下,我们需要在Android设备上使用awk命令进行文本处理,但是发现设备不识别awk命令,这是因为Android本身并没有集成awk命令。要使用awk命令,我们需要安装busybox工具。 什么是Busybox Busybox是一个单一可执行文件的工具箱,它包含了常用Linux命令的…

    database 2023年5月22日
    00
合作推广
合作推广
分享本页
返回顶部